DS front grinding/scraping niose
I was driving my f-350 today and it started to grind/scrape when I was slowing down to a stop or just taking off from a stop. Ounce I got up to about 30/40 mph it would go away. I drove about 75 miles non stop and it was quiet as can be. As soon as I slowed down at the end of the ramp it came back. I have had both sides apart recently and have serviced all the bearings, u-jionts ect. I popped a wheel off and checked the DS pads and they look fine? Any help would be great.
